Overview

Examines those pathological conditions constituting internalizing disorders as a special class of psychological problems in children and adolescents. Looking at these aliments as a related group helps clarify their dynamics and the prospects for intervention. Coverage includes depression, suicide, anxiety, somatic and obsessive compulsive disorders as well as the taxonomy and classification of internalizing conditions plus updated information on their nature, diagnosis, assessment and treatment.

Booknews

Treats internalizing disorders as a distinct class of related pathological conditions--including depression, obsessive compulsive disorders, anxiety disorders, suicidal behaviors, and somatic disorders--examining the concept of internalization as a mental process that can become disordered, and clarifying the dynamics of internalizing disorders and the prospects for intervention with them.
